½ Giulio - Julius II
Issuer | Macerata (Papal States) |
Year | 1503-1513 |
Type | Standard circulation coin |
Value | ½ Giulio (1) |
Currency | Groschen (1188-1534) |
Composition | Silver (.9202) |
Weight | 1.85 g |
Dimensions | 24 mm |

Reference(s) | Munt#72 , Berman#594 , CNI XIII#55 , MIR#602 |
Obverse description | Papal arms with decagonal (horsehead shaped) shield in quadrilobe. |
Obverse script | Latin |
Obverse lettering | ⸰
IVLIVS ⸰ II ⸰ ⸰ PONT ⸰ MAX ⸰ (Translation: Julius II Supreme Pontiff) |
Reverse description | Crossed keys bound with a cord, beneath pavilion, within circle. |
Reverse script | Latin |
Reverse lettering | ⸰
CLAVES ⸰ REGNI ⸰ CELORVM ⸰ MARC ⸰ (Translation: Keys to the Kingdom of Heaven, March (of Ancona)) |
